<p>Maibock, does anything say early summer better. Malty and hoppy all at the same time.</p>
<p>Appearance: An half inch white foamy head atop a orange-amber beverage.</p>
<p>Aroma: Citrus and honey on the nose.</p>
<p>Taste and mouth: Full mouth from this malt bomb followed by a near pale ale bitterness.</p>
<p>Overall: Not having many maibocks, this is a good beer that is worth drinking a time or two.</p>
